Bawasa Malla is a Rural village located in Bironkhal, Pauri-garhwal,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Bawasa Malla is 299.
Bawasa Malla village comprises 71 households.
The literacy rate in Bawasa Malla is 76.9%. Among the literate population of 210, there are 107 literate males and 103 literate females.
In Bawasa Malla, there are 136 males and 163 females, with a sex ratio of 1199 females per 1000 males.
There are 26 children (8.7% of population), comprising 16 boys and 10 girls.
The total number of workers in Bawasa Malla is 127, with 82 main workers and 45 marginal workers.
In Bawasa Malla, there are 49 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(25 males, 24 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Bawasa Malla is located in Uttarakhand state, Pauri-garhwal district, and falls under Bironkhal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 46859 and LGD code is 46859.
